Due to insufficient
ionization the burner
has shut down after
ignition
Ionization flow,
ionization cable or
02 setting
Ignition Failure Issue
Flame Failure Issue
Note: if ionization is lost while the flame is
burning no E02 will occur - unit will attempt to
relight 6 times. E02 only occurs after 6 failed
attempts for re-ignition.
Propane gas with low BTU value or a brand
new tank that may contain something other
than pure propane may cause E02. Check
against a good known source of gas.
The minimum ionization current
should be 4 micro amps (Check
INFO step 48, the O2 should be a
minimum of 4.4% for NG or 4.8%
for LP.
